Output 20718b4bb642b4305aa60e000d91b774cca44a4ea8eff3e0496c2a1628953eda:1

value
3025023791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0165d1f66d48de10bcc2c3ec28a9cb12eee9aa9a OP_EQUAL
address
31pQaKnnqpN4iQWNhdmmzjyqfBGHy3HU9U
transaction
20718b4bb642b4305aa60e000d91b774cca44a4ea8eff3e0496c2a1628953eda
spent
true